## Changelog — Pellit API v4.2

Heads up, support folks: we changed the default page size on all public list endpoints from 100 to 25. Customers who never passed a `per_page` param will suddenly see shorter responses — that's expected, not a bug. Cursor pagination is now the default too; offset mode still works but logs a deprecation warning. The current defaults are below.

settings of fafog-haduf:
ZORIX_PIN=4648
ZORIX_METRICS_HOST=metrics.zorix.paliqsys.corp
ZORIX_LOG_LEVEL=info
ZORIX_TENANT=druix

## Onboarding: Farebranch Rules Engine

Plugin authors integrate with Farebranch by registering fee rules against the evaluation API. Rules are sandboxed; they cannot perform network calls directly. All rate-table lookups go through the host, which validates your plugin manifest at load time. Your local env file must include the signing credential the host uses to verify manifests, set on the next line.

secret setting of bajef-fajof: COURIER_KEY3=76c

## Releases

The Marroway nightly search reindex kicks off at 02:00 and usually finishes before the weekly sync. Release cuts should wait until the reindex completes, since partial indexes fail the smoke suite. Status is posted to the eng channel automatically. Each reindex artifact is signed before upload using the key that follows.

release key, fajef-kajeg: bky19_LdLu6Ne6FLi8he2c24d

Subject: Pilot churn — where we stand

Hi team,

Quick update for our incoming director on the Larchgate pilot. We've lost 9 of 60 pilot customers this quarter — mostly smaller accounts citing onboarding friction, not pricing. Renna's group is reworking the setup flow, and early feedback from the Copperfen cohort is encouraging. I'd call this fixable, not fatal. Full breakdown attached. The context that frames our response sits just below.

confidential, hahap-bahaf: Fenathix Freight plans to lower the Sildor list price by 53.5 percent in November. The board signed off on a budget of $241.8 million for Project Druwyn. The renewal with Holvanax Foods closes at $381.7 million a year, 25.5 percent below the last contract. Project Silmir slips by one quarter because of the supplier delay.